Where to see lemurs (without cheating)
Indris, crowned, golden sifakas, ring-tails: the honest guide to encounters, North to South.
The near-guaranteed
In Andasibe, the indri — the world's largest lemur — sings every morning. On Amber Mountain, crowned lemurs cross the main trails. On Nosy Komba, black lemurs have been used to visitors for generations.
The earned ones
The golden-crowned sifaka of Daraina is found nowhere else on Earth — one of the treasures of our Vanilla Coast. In Ranomafana, the golden bamboo lemur demands patience. And everywhere, the nocturnal grail: the mouse lemur, spotted by headlamp.
The golden rule
No feeding outside traditional sites, distance respected, no flash. A wild lemur stays wild.
